9 and 10 have arrived. Number ten needed assistance but is up and about and doing fine. Number 11 was candled last night. It has internally pipped and is moving but there is still no external pip. We will do a manual pip later today. We've achieved a 90% hatch but are trying for the 100%. Fingers crossed.

Tried to help number 11 but he is gone. We did the pip and verified before removing enough of the shell to verify. In hindsight, we should have done the external pip for him last night while he was moving around.

Awesome! Congrats! To me, it looks like that particular egg did not loose enough moisture. Maybe the shell was thicker/less porous. The air cell marking and the fact that from the pic it looks like a lot of excess fluid in there, I'd say it pipped and aspirated on the fluid. That's my hypothesis.
